Maintenance
Service Intervals
Oil Change: Check oil injection system periodically; oil change not applicable in the traditional sense, but oil level in the injection reservoir should be maintained.
Spark Plug Replacement: Every 1,000-1,500 miles or annually, depending on usage and condition.
Clutch Inspection: Inspect primary and secondary clutches annually for belt wear, roller condition, and spring tension.
Track Tension Adjustment: Check and adjust track tension every 500 miles or as needed, especially after initial break-in or heavy use.
Lubrication: Grease suspension pivot points, steering components, and driveshaft bearings annually or every 1,000 miles.
Fluid Specifications
Engine Oil Injection: Yamaha Biodegradable 2-Stroke Snowmobile Oil (or equivalent high-quality JASO FD certified 2-stroke oil).
Brake Fluid: DOT 3 or DOT 4 hydraulic brake fluid.
Chaincase Oil: Yamaha Gear Oil (or equivalent SAE 80W-90 hypoid gear oil).
Coolant: N/A (Fan-cooled engine)
Known Issues
Carburetor Issues: Carburetors can become clogged with age or improper fuel storage, requiring cleaning and tuning.
Clutch Wear: Worn clutch rollers or sheaves can lead to poor acceleration and belt slippage.
Oil Injection System: The oil injection pump or lines can sometimes clog or fail, requiring inspection and potential replacement to prevent engine damage.
Track Tension: Improper track tension can lead to excessive wear on the track, sliders, and drive sprockets.
